WYSIWYG : What You See Is What You Get
WYSIWYG signifie What You See Is WhatYou Get. C'est une façon d'éditer des pages web sans passer par le langage HTML. On ne voit ni codeHTML barbare, ni la cabalistique syntaxe wiki.
Les éditeurs wysiwyg en ligne les plus connus sont :
- htmlarea - abandonné, je ne sais même pas s'il est encore distribué.
- spawn
- FCKeditor : le plus évolué que jeconnaisse, énormément de fonctionnalités, skinable, et gratuit /open-source / LGPL.
- Cross-Browser Rich Text Editor : super light, gratuit, open-source.
- Il y a aussi l'éditeur de Radio qui marche bien sur IE et Moz.
- TinyMCE : un autre éditeur javascript joli et bien fichu. (Le principe ici est de transformer les TEXTAREA en zones éditables).
- SynchoEdit : comme sont nom l'indique, cet éditeur est collaboratif : vous pouvez éditeur le même document à plusieurs en même temps.
- Une sélection d'éditeurs de texte riches : listing intéressant sur la ferme du web.
MarkItUp : wysiwyg editor basé sur jQuery. Semble très très bien. (devrait sans doute supplanter FCKeditor).- Xinha : semble très bon aussi, et très utilisé (intégré à SPIP, Joomla ...).
Enfin, il existe un grand répertoire d'éditeurs wysiwyg en ligne : htmlarea.com (plus de 80 listés, la majorité payants).
Le compromis à réussir, pour une personne qui veut rendre son site webéditable facilement avec un éditeur wysiwyg, c'est de trouver le justeéquilibre entre un truc qui fasse ce qu'il faut sans être ni tropcompliqué, ni trop lourd.
Créer l'éditeur soi-même
Comme souvent, si l'on est pas content de ce qui existe, on peut se programmer un éditeur soi-même :
- Tutoriel expliquant comment créer un éditeur wysiwyg avec IE 5+
- Mozilla Editor, et notamment Rich Text Editing.
Voir aussi : Edit in place with JavaScript and CSS : on double click sur un paragraphe et hop, il se met à être éditable. (fini les boutons "éditer").
Restant à faire dans mon JRTE
Le Javascript Rich Text Editor est satisfaisant pour le moment.
Dans un futur incertain, l'idéal serait d'être capable d'ajouter une chaine quelconquedans l'éditeur, afin d'implémenter une petite série de liens interwikisvisuels :
- recherche Google
- status images de Jabber, ICQ, AIM, ...
- un tableau ?
- un livre
- un CD
- un film
- un feed rss
- une machine à café
Mais pour le moment, on se satisfera de l'état actuel.
Tags : webware javascript IE Mozilla
Pages ayant pour tag : wysiwyg
- fckeditor : FCK editor
Ecrire votre commentaire
Vous devez vous connecter pour pouvoir ajouter un commentaire.